About the Job
Under the supervision of the Technical Head/ MCH Specialty Centre Manager, Porter in the Maternal and Child Health center is responsible for ensuring the cleanliness, safety, client handling and efficient operation of the MCH. This role includes transporting patients, equipment, and supplies within the facility and providing general support to the healthcare staff.
- Duties and Tasks:
- Safely transport patients to and from various locations within the facility.
- Assist patients in and out of wheelchairs, beds, and other transport devices.
- Move medical equipment and supplies to and from the MCH department as needed.
- Ensure all equipment is clean, functional, and properly stored.
- Ensure cleanliness in patient rooms, waiting areas, and other designated areas within the MCH department.
- Adhere to all health and safety guidelines to ensure a safe environment for patients, staff, and visitors.
- Report any hazards or potential safety issues to the supervisor.
- Assist nursing and medical staff with various tasks as requested.
- Provide excellent customer service to patients, families, and visitors.
- Maintain accurate records of transported patients, equipment, and supplies.
- Complete any necessary documentation related to transport and cleaning activities.
- Perform other related duties as assigned by the MCH Supervisor/Manager.
Job Specification:
Education and Experience:
- 01 year Experience
- Vocational school diploma or equivalent.
- Previous experience in a hospital or healthcare setting preferred.
- Basic knowledge of healthcare operations and patient care.
Skills and Competencies:
- Ability to perform physical tasks such as lifting, pushing, and transporting patients and equipment.
- Good verbal communication skills to interact effectively with patients, staff, and visitors.
- Strong commitment to providing high-quality customer service.
- Ability to follow procedures accurately and maintain cleanliness and safety standards.
- Ability to work collaboratively with healthcare staff and other porters.
Personal Attributes:
- Empathy and Compassion: Sensitivity to the needs and concerns of patients and their families.
- Reliability: Dependable and punctual with a strong work ethic.
- Flexibility: Ability to adapt to changing schedules and priorities.
